Central vacuum installation involves setting up a built-in vacuum system throughout a home or property. This service typically includes installing a central unit in a designated area, such as a garage or utility room, and running a network of pipes or hoses through the walls to connect to various inlets around the property. Once installed, homeowners can easily access the system by plugging a vacuum hose into these inlets, enabling efficient and powerful cleaning without lugging around heavy portable units. Local service providers can handle everything from the initial planning and placement to the precise installation of the piping and electrical connections, ensuring the system functions smoothly and effectively.

This service helps solve common cleaning challenges faced by homeowners, such as the inconvenience of carrying a portable vacuum from room to room, or the limited power of traditional handheld units. Central vacuum systems are especially effective at removing dust, dirt, and allergens from deep within carpets and upholstery, contributing to a cleaner indoor environment. They also tend to be quieter during operation and require less maintenance over time. For homes with allergy sufferers or residents who prioritize indoor air quality, a central vacuum can make a noticeable difference in maintaining a healthier living space.

The overview below groups typical Central Vacuum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rock Hill,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or repairs or component replacements in Rock Hill, SC,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like fixing leaks or replacing a section of pipe.

Basic Installation - Installing a new central vacuum system in a standard home usually costs between $1,200 and $2,500. Local contractors often complete these projects within this range, depending on home size and system features.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an existing central vacuum setup or installing a system in a larger property can cost from $3,000 to $5,500. Larger or more complex projects tend to push into this higher tier, though many projects stay in the mid-range.

Custom or Commercial Installations - Larger, custom, or commercial-grade systems in the Rock Hill area can range from $6,000 to $15,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ve specialized requirements or extensive ductwork.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a central vacuum system? Local contractors typically handle the installation process, which includes planning the ductwork layout, mounting the main unit, and connecting the pipes throughout the home.

Can a central vacuum system be added to an existing home? Yes, experienced service providers can often install a central vacuum system in existing homes, assessing the structure to determine the best placement for the units and piping.

What types of homes are suitable for central vacuum installation? Central vacuum systems can be installed in a variety of resid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and certain multi-story buildings, depending on the layout.

Are there different types of central vacuum systems available? Yes, local contractors offer various models, including units with different power levels and features to suit specific home sizes and cleaning needs.
